BYD unveils 1,100-horsepower electric all-terrain vehicle and supercar with 0-60 mph in 2 seconds

Each U8 electric motor produces 220-240 kilowatts (299-326 hp) and 320-420 Nm, which in total allows you to get more than 1100 peak recoil forces. Up to a hundred, the electric car accelerates in three seconds, and for braking up to 1.08 g it uses only electric motors. Because all-wheel drive is electric, it reacts 100 times faster than mechanical all-wheel drive, plus it gives you 20 times more traction control.
